Quote:
But the ride — which Universal officials had referred to for months by the code name "Project Rumble" — still draws principally on the basic thrills of a roller coaster: speed, height, loops, corkscrews, twists, turns and drops. Universal officials said Rockit would have several signature moves and a record-breaking loop, though they would not elaborate. The artist's rendering that they released shows the track climbing a 167-foot-tall peak, then corkscrewing downward, twisting eight times.


I assume this Maurer will feature eight inversions. If that's true, it would be the coaster with most inversions in the States and, according to the press release, the coaster will feature the tallest loop (I guess it will be a sort of Sky Loop).

I can't imagine a coaster that big fitting in the Studios although we thought the same about Hollywood Dream: The Ride and ended up being one of the best integrated coasters in a park and exceeded everyone's expectations.

BTW, knowing how low-capacity are Maurer coaster, I wonder how many cars are they going to run at the same time and thus, how long the track will be.

Wasn't there something on this before...? I could've sworn I mentioned this in that "Florida Big for 2009" topic and Mike T posted stuff there on the planning permission and things like that...perhaps a topic merger would be in order...?

Anyways, supposedly initial plans called for this to be a B&M Hyper along the lines of Hollywood Dream, but B&M stated they were too busy to get the ride open for 2009 (the planned opening year), which made sense given the SeaWorld Flyer, the supposed Hypers (KI, Mirabilandia), and numerous other rumored projects...
